  • Patent number: 7895921
    Abstract: A ratchet tool includes a head and a handle, a ratchet is received in the space and two pawl sets are respectively received in two recesses defined in the inner periphery of the space. Each pawl set has a pawl and a spring which biases the pawl to be engaged with the teeth of the ratchet. Each pawl has a flat surface defined in the end having the engaging teeth. An operation member has a flange which is rotatably engaged with a groove defined in the inner periphery of the space and the flange includes a pressing surface which presses one of the flat surfaces of the two pawls by operating the operation member. By choosing one of the pawls to be engaged with the ratchet, the ratchet tool can output torque in desired direction.

  • Patent number: 7692742
    Abstract: A transflective liquid crystal display is provided. The electric fields of reflective regions are adjusted by arranging resistors between transmissive electrodes and reflectors or by disposing reflectors floating on the transmissive electrodes and ground electrodes so that the phase shift of liquid crystal layer in the reflective region and transmissive region can be controlled. Accordingly, the transmissive area and reflective area can be kept substantially identical in thickness and the complex process for manufacturing double gap structure is thus not required.
